Marketing Executive - Demand Generation

Marketing Executive - Demand Generation

London Full-Time 28000 - 42000 £ / year (est.) No home office possible
Go Premium
I

At a Glance

  • Tasks: Lead demand generation efforts and create impactful marketing campaigns.
  • Company: Join Thomas Telford, a leader in civil engineering knowledge and services.
  • Benefits: Enjoy 25 days leave, wellbeing vouchers, and a cycle to work scheme.
  • Why this job: Be part of a dynamic team driving revenue growth and making an impact.
  • Qualifications: Degree level education and experience in B2B marketing preferred.
  • Other info: Hybrid working in London with a focus on collaboration and innovation.

The predicted salary is between 28000 - 42000 £ per year.

Location – Hybrid – London, Westminster

Hours – 36.5 per week

Salary - £35,000 + Benefits

Thomas Telford is the knowledge business of the Institution of Civil Engineers (ICE), creating specialist products and services for the civil engineering and construction markets. These include the bestselling NEC® suite of contracts and guides. We also provide a recruitment service with the ICE Recruit job board and technical training and accreditation for ICE members and those in the wider construction sector.

The Role: Thomas Telford (TTL) is seeking a Demand Generation Marketing Executive to lead generation efforts to build a sales pipeline and help drive revenue growth. Create, implement and optimise impactful campaigns to reach and engage the target audience. This role supports the entire marketing process, from concept development to execution and analysis, ensuring each campaign aligns with the broader marketing objectives.

Key Accountabilities:

  • Drive new customer acquisition through TTL demand generation strategy.
  • Implement marketing activities to attract new prospects.
  • Support brand awareness to educate prospects on TTL solutions.
  • Develop nurturing strategies to convert engaged audiences into leads.
  • Create impactful content for lead nurturing.
  • Collaborate with Sales to achieve annual net revenue growth.
  • Build strong relationships with staff, customers, prospects, and associations.
  • Maintain a professional image of TTL in the market.
  • Define campaign requirements, target audiences, key messages, and create assets.
  • Understand market segments and target audiences to inform marketing plans.
  • Align customer buyer journey with marketing and sales strategies.
  • Ensure messaging addresses customer needs and pain points.
  • Update customer personas and value propositions regularly.
  • Develop tools, content, and resources to support sales teams.
  • Track metrics and KPIs to measure campaign success.
  • Balance multiple tasks and collaborate with marketing team members.
  • Support TTL marketing team and align priorities with other TTL teams.
  • Communicate clearly and escalate issues as needed.

Skills and Experience:

  • Knowledge of email and CRM systems (Campaign Monitor, Salesforce)
  • Hands-on digital marketing channels expertise (email, SEO, PPC, social media)
  • Strong copywriting and editing skills
  • Understanding of subscription-based B2B information services
  • Organise and execute projects on time and within budget
  • Manage multiple tasks simultaneously and work to tight deadlines
  • Excellent written English and communication skills
  • Highly self-motivated, intuitive, energetic and with great attention to detail
  • Proven experience in a marketing role, preferably in B2B information
  • Experience using email marketing platforms, plus other digital channels
  • Experience in campaign tracking, reporting, and analytics
  • Well-organised with a structured approach to projects
  • Verbal and written communication skills
  • Excellent collaboration skills, able to work effectively across departments and teams
  • Self-motivated, comfortable using own initiative

Qualifications:

  • Educated to degree level or equivalent
  • Preferably a professional qualification in marketing or business – MBA, CIM, IDM

ICE Group Benefits Include:

  • 25 days annual leave (pro-rata) plus public holidays
  • Christmas office shutdown
  • £100 wellbeing voucher
  • Pension contributions of up to 8%
  • 24-hour employee assistance line
  • Death in service benefit (1x annual salary)
  • Interest-free season ticket loan
  • Cycle to work scheme.
  • Discounted gym memberships through Gymflex

Thomas Telford Ltd is an equal opportunities employer and welcomes applications from all sections of the community.

General Data Protection Regulations (GDPR) 2018 The data collected via this application process will only be used by the ICE Group for the purpose of recruitment and for the performance of an employment contract if a job offer is made. This data will not be disclosed to any external sources without express consent unless required to do so by law. Unsuccessful applicants’ data, both electronic and paper will be deleted/shredded six months from date of application. The ICE Group’s Data Protection Officer is Shah Ali, who can be contacted at shah.ali@ice.org.uk. Applicants have the right to complain to the ICO at http://ico.org.uk/ if they have a concern with the way ICE is handling their data.

I

Contact Detail:

Institution of Civil Engineers (ICE)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Marketing Executive - Demand Generation

✨Tip Number 1

Familiarise yourself with the latest trends in demand generation marketing. Understanding current strategies and tools will help you speak confidently about how you can contribute to TTL's goals during interviews.

✨Tip Number 2

Network with professionals in the civil engineering and construction sectors. Attend industry events or join relevant online forums to build connections that could provide insights into the role and potentially lead to referrals.

✨Tip Number 3

Prepare to discuss specific campaigns you've worked on in the past. Be ready to share metrics and outcomes, as this will demonstrate your ability to drive results and align with TTL's focus on measurable success.

✨Tip Number 4

Showcase your knowledge of CRM and email marketing platforms like Salesforce and Campaign Monitor. Being able to discuss your hands-on experience with these tools will set you apart as a candidate who can hit the ground running.

We think you need these skills to ace Marketing Executive - Demand Generation

Email Marketing Expertise
CRM Systems Knowledge (e.g., Salesforce, Campaign Monitor)
Digital Marketing Channels Proficiency (SEO, PPC, Social Media)
Strong Copywriting and Editing Skills
B2B Marketing Experience
Campaign Tracking and Analytics
Project Management Skills
Attention to Detail
Excellent Verbal and Written Communication Skills
Collaboration and Teamwork
Self-Motivation and Initiative
Ability to Manage Multiple Tasks
Understanding of Customer Buyer Journey
Market Segmentation Analysis

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ights relevant experience in demand generation and digital marketing. Use keywords from the job description to demonstrate that you meet the specific requirements of the role.

Craft a Compelling Cover Letter: Write a cover letter that showcases your understanding of TTL's mission and how your skills can contribute to their demand generation strategy. Be sure to mention any specific campaigns or projects you've worked on that align with their goals.

Showcase Your Skills: In your application, emphasise your expertise in email marketing, CRM systems, and digital marketing channels. Provide examples of successful campaigns you've executed and the metrics that demonstrate their success.

Proofread Your Application: Before submitting, carefully proofread your CV and cover letter for any spelling or grammatical errors. A polished application reflects your attention to detail, which is crucial for a marketing role.

How to prepare for a job interview at Institution of Civil Engineers (ICE)

✨Know Your Campaigns

Familiarise yourself with recent demand generation campaigns in the industry. Be prepared to discuss how you would create, implement, and optimise similar campaigns for Thomas Telford, showcasing your understanding of their target audience.

✨Showcase Your Digital Skills

Highlight your hands-on experience with digital marketing channels such as email, SEO, PPC, and social media. Be ready to provide examples of how you've successfully used these tools to drive customer acquisition and engagement.

✨Understand the Customer Journey

Demonstrate your knowledge of the customer buyer journey and how it aligns with marketing and sales strategies. Discuss how you would tailor messaging to address customer needs and pain points effectively.

✨Collaboration is Key

Emphasise your collaboration skills and ability to work across departments. Prepare to share examples of how you've successfully partnered with sales teams or other departments to achieve common goals in previous roles.

Marketing Executive - Demand Generation
Institution of Civil Engineers (ICE)
Location: London
Go Premium

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

I
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>